On March 8, 2011, Citizens for Responsibility and Ethics in Washington (CREW) asked the Internal Revenue Service (IRS) to investigate whether the American Action Network (AAN) has violated tax law. While AAN - chaired by former Republican Senator Norm Coleman - is organized as a tax-exempt organization under section 501(c)(4) of the tax code, it spent tens of millions of dollars persuading Americans to vote against Democratic congressional candidates in the 2010 elections.
